In what ways can speed control of hydraulic cylinders be achieved?
Hydraulic cylinder is a kind of hydraulic energy into mechanical energy, do linear reciprocating motion or oscillating motion of the hydraulic actuator. It consists of cylinder barrel and cylinder head, piston and piston rod, sealing device, buffer device and exhaust device.
The speed control of the device can be realized in the following ways:
1, throttle adjustment: by changing the flow of the device to control its speed. Throttle has two types of manual adjustment and automatic adjustment, manual adjustment is by rotating the knob to change the opening size of the throttle valve, automatic adjustment is through the pressure and flow sensor to automatically adjust the opening size of the throttle valve.
2, speed control valve adjustment: speed control valve is a combination of throttle valve and relief valve, by changing the size of the opening of the speed control valve, you can change the flow of hydraulic oil, thereby controlling the speed of the hydraulic cylinder.
3, proportional valve adjustment: proportional valve is a kind of valve can be adjusted in proportion to the size of the opening, through the electric signal to automatically adjust the flow of hydraulic oil, so as to control the speed of the device.
4, servo valve adjustment: servo valve is a high-precision control valve, through the feedback signal to automatically adjust the flow of hydraulic oil, thereby controlling the speed of the device.
In addition to the above ways, you can also change the displacement of the hydraulic pump, the use of differential connection and other ways to control the speed. The speed of the hydraulic cylinder depends on the flow rate of the hydraulic oil and the piston area of the hydraulic cylinder, so the speed control needs to be specifically adjusted in combination with the actual situation.
